Carbonate reservoirs play a very important role in the world’s gas and oil resources, and the statistical data shows40percent of the236giant oilfields belong to carbonate oil reservoirs. The main mining method of carbonate resource is to adopt horizontal and acid fractured lateral well technique. Based on a great amount of literature about carbonate reservoir well test analysis, this paper investiages carbonate horizontal and acid fractured horizontal well test. We set dual medium and triple-medium well test analysis models in order to capture the character of carbonate reservoir. Applying semi-analytical method, we obtained the solution in Laplace domain, and with the help of computer programming, the typical curve can be easily plotted with Stehfest algorithm and different regimes can be identified then. The main ideas carried out from this research are the following:1) According to the different combination of natural fracture、cave and matrix in carbonate reservoir, this paper devide this type of reservoir into two model for research: dual-medium model and triple-medium model.2) Set up the dual-medium reservior well analysis model of horizontal and acid fractured horizontal (considering infinite conductivity and finite conductivity fracture) well with two parallel planes sealed both on top and bottom; apply point-source function method for analysis solution, then draft the typical curve with the aid of programming. Identify the flow regimes base on the typical curve, and deeply analyze the effect of sensitive factor, such as storability ratio and inter-porosity flow coefficient on the pseudo-pressure responses.3) Model triple-medium parallel planes sealed oil reservoir by consider the seepage type are triporate-uniphase parallel flow and triporate-uniphase step-by-step flow; establish infinite-conductivity and finite-conductivity fissure flow model for acid fractured horizontal wells. Realize the typical curve with the aid of programming techniques and identify the flow regimes on the basis of typical curve, then analyze the sensitive factor.4) Utilize the horizontal recovery pressure data from X carbonate oil field in Xinjiang province for well-test interpretation, which can verify the rationality and validity of the model presented by this article.
